Implementation of the CoAP Protocol.
This library provides both a client interface (CoAPClient
)
and a server interface (CoAPServer
).
Installation
First add this to your Cargo.toml
:
[dependencies]
coap = "0.5"
Then, add this to your crate root:
extern crate coap;
Example
Server:
extern crate coap; use std::io; use coap::{CoAPServer, CoAPClient, CoAPRequest, CoAPResponse}; fn request_handler(request: CoAPRequest) -> Option<CoAPResponse> { println!("Receive request: {:?}", request); // Return the auto-generated response request.response } fn main() { let addr = "127.0.0.1:5683"; let mut server = CoAPServer::new(addr).unwrap(); server.handle(request_handler).unwrap(); println!("Server up on {}", addr); println!("Press any key to stop..."); io::stdin().read_line(&mut String::new()).unwrap(); println!("Server shutdown"); }
Client:
extern crate coap; use coap::message::response::CoAPResponse; use coap::CoAPClient; fn main() { let url = "coap://127.0.0.1:5683/Rust"; println!("Client request: {}", url); let response: CoAPResponse = CoAPClient::request(url).unwrap(); println!("Server reply: {}", String::from_utf8(response.message.payload).unwrap()); }
